i have a place to shoot lol...I need a range finder like a device that tells me the distance to an object.
If your looking out to 400 yards on a furry critter, I have one to sell you cheap. If your looking to go out to 1000-2400 yards, get a Sig. The distances for a reflective object that is ranged is twice what a furry critter will range with the same device.
I've ranged a barn at 2400 yards and then drove the distance and it was as exact as my odometer.
They also do the ranging for bowhunting where your shooting up to a 45 degree angle uphill or downhill automatically.
